#pragma once
#include "PowerFSM.h"
#include "concurrency/OSThread.h"
#include "configuration.h"
#include "main.h"
#include "sleep.h"
#ifdef HAS_I2S
#include <AudioFileSourcePROGMEM.h>
#include <AudioGeneratorRTTTL.h>
#include <AudioOutputI2S.h>
#include <ESP8266SAM.h>
#define AUDIO_THREAD_INTERVAL_MS 100
class AudioThread : public concurrency::OSThread
{
public:
AudioThread() : OSThread("Audio") { initOutput(); }
void beginRttl(const void *data, uint32_t len)
{
setCPUFast(true);
rtttlFile = new AudioFileSourcePROGMEM(data, len);
i2sRtttl = new AudioGeneratorRTTTL();
i2sRtttl->begin(rtttlFile, audioOut);
}
// Also handles actually playing the RTTTL, needs to be called in loop
bool isPlaying()
{
if (i2sRtttl != nullptr) {
return i2sRtttl->isRunning() && i2sRtttl->loop();
}
return false;
}
void stop()
{
if (i2sRtttl != nullptr) {
i2sRtttl->stop();
delete i2sRtttl;
i2sRtttl = nullptr;
}
delete rtttlFile;
rtttlFile = nullptr;
setCPUFast(false);
}
void readAloud(const char *text)
{
if (i2sRtttl != nullptr) {
i2sRtttl->stop();
delete i2sRtttl;
i2sRtttl = nullptr;
}
ESP8266SAM *sam = new ESP8266SAM;
sam->Say(audioOut, text);
delete sam;
setCPUFast(false);
}
protected:
int32_t runOnce() override
{
canSleep = true; // Assume we should not keep the board awake
// if (i2sRtttl != nullptr && i2sRtttl->isRunning()) {
// i2sRtttl->loop();
// }
return AUDIO_THREAD_INTERVAL_MS;
}
private:
void initOutput()
{
audioOut = new AudioOutputI2S(1, AudioOutputI2S::EXTERNAL_I2S);
audioOut->SetPinout(DAC_I2S_BCK, DAC_I2S_WS, DAC_I2S_DOUT, DAC_I2S_MCLK);
audioOut->SetGain(0.2);
};
AudioGeneratorRTTTL *i2sRtttl = nullptr;
AudioOutputI2S *audioOut;
AudioFileSourcePROGMEM *rtttlFile;
};
#endif
